Redhair Swimming Crab
Achelous ordwayi
- Group: Crab
- Typical depth: 0–366 m
- Max size: 1.1 cm
A tiny swimming crab barely a centimetre across, the redhair swimming crab lives among molluscan and other shells out over a wide depth range. It rows through the water on flattened back legs rather than only crawling, as its swimming crab kin do.
Taxonomy: Animalia › Arthropoda › Malacostraca › Decapoda › Portunidae › Achelous
